Cleaning/Degreasing Floor.

What Do You All Recommend As Far As Cleaning The Floor? Degreaser, Soap Or Just Broom And Water? I’m At Stage Where Im About To Treat The Floor For Rust And Want Some Advice.

This stuff from ZEP works great and is available in larger 1 gallon bottles.
Make sure it's the "Heavy Duty" variant, and use it full strength/undiluted.
Also be careful and don't use on finished/painted surfaces as it will attack the top layer and dull it out. Ask me how I know...
